Kiss Kiss (Bang Bang) is a 2001 British comedy film written and directed by Stewart Sugg.[1] It features Stellan Skarsgård, Chris Penn, and Paul Bettany.[2]

Plot

Felix is a hitman who wants out of the business. He takes up a job to look after a reclusive man named Bubba who is like a giant kid, he does not understand people and does not know much, never having seen the outside world before. But Felix has bigger problems. He wants to patch up his relationship with his ex-girlfriend, and he's being targeted by his old colleagues who are not letting him get away from his past so easily.[3]
